The Lost Language of the Guitar Mastering chords was never just about pressing fingers down; it was about developing a physical vocabulary.

We learned that a C major chord demanded a specific geometry of space, a D7th required a stretch that felt like a physical challenge, and an Em could evoke melancholy with minimal effort.
